学习动态性能表

18--V$SYSTEM_EVENT  2007.6.13

  本视图概括了实例各项事件的等待信息。v$session_wait显示了系统的当前等待项,v$system_event则提供了自实例启动后各个等待事件的概括。常用于获取系统等待信息的历史影象。而通过两个snapshot获取等待项增量,则可以确定这段时间内系统的等待项。

V$SYSTEM_EVENT中的常用列

  • EVENT:等待事件名称
  • TOTAL_WAITS:此项事件总等待次数
  • TIME_WAITED:此项事件的总等待时间(单位:百分之一秒)
  • AVERAGE_WAIT:此项事件的平均等待用时(单位:百分之一秒)(time_waited/total_waits)
  • TOTAL_TIMEOUTS:此项事情总等待超时次数

示例:

1.查看系统的各项等待,按总耗时排序

SELECT event,total_waits waits,total_timeouts timeouts,

time_waited total_time,average_wait avg

FROM V$SYSTEM_EVENT

ORDER BY 4 DESC;

比如,通过checkpoint completed、log file switch(checkpoint incomplete)可以查看检查点进程的性能。通过log file parallel write、log file switch completed可以查看联机重做日志文件的性能。通过log file switch(archiving needed)事件可以检查归档进程的性能。

找出瓶颈:

1。通过Statspack列出空闲事件。

2。检查不同事件的等待时间开销。

3。检查每条等待记录的平均用时,因为某些等待事件(比较log file switch completion)可能周期性地发生,但发生时却造成了严重的性能损耗。

最新文章

  1. .NET LINQ 串联运算
  2. 水坑式攻击-APT攻击常见手段
  3. 使用MVVM框架avalon.js实现一个简易日历
  4. Win7旗舰版的nfs服务器如何架设? - Microsoft Community
  5. HDU 5145 - NPY and girls
  6. Android两个注意事项.深入了解Intent和IntentFilter(两)
  7. git合并历史提交
  8. spring boot / cloud (十九) 并发消费消息,如何保证入库的数据是最新的?
  9. Linux - 修改系统的max open files、max user processes (附ulimit的使用方法)
  10. Jquery 一个页面多个倒计时 实现
  11. Mysql加锁过程详解(4)-select for update/lock in share mode 对事务并发性影响
  12. Comet OJ - Contest #0
  13. markdownpad目录格式配置
  14. react-router 4.0(三)根据当前url显示导航
  15. golang 报错illegal rune literal
  16. java发生邮件(转)
  17. MySql数据库迁移图文展示
  18. BZOJ 1191 超级英雄Hero 二分图匹配
  19. java中long型时间戳的计算
  20. 如何预编译ASP.Net程序

热门文章

  1. Kafka Confluent
  2. android 加固防止反编译-重新打包
  3. ORA-01034和ORA-27101的错误
  4. 搭建配置cacti,采集信息监控
  5. php执行shell不阻塞方法
  6. android.intent.category.LAUNCHER和android.intent.action.MAIN
  7. DataX的安装
  8. Eclipse安装SVN客户端
  9. Dom4j quick start guide
  10. JMeter ——Test fragment